On May 5, 2015, the Council of the European Union issued a press release stating it had reached a tentative agreement with the European Parliament on a draft directive that would further the development of electronic payments in the EU market. The new directive will incorporate and repeal the existing Payment Services Directive to create a new framework for emerging and innovative payment services, including internet and mobile payments, providing a more secure and harmonized environment for payments. Once the full text is finalized, the draft directive will need to be confirmed by the Council, submitted to the European Parliament for a vote and then to the Council for adoption. Once adopted, member states will have two years to transpose the directive into national law.
